Payne out of Lions opener

9:58 am on 2 June 2017

The British and Irish Lions' New Zealand-born centre Jared Payne has been ruled out of tomorrow's tour opener against the New Zealand Provincial Barbarians with a calf strain.

The 31-year-old Ireland centre, who would have been in line for a homecoming at the game in Whangarei having played for Northland in New Zealand's provincial competition, has been replaced on the bench by England's Elliot Daly.

The Lions, who arrived in New Zealand on Wednesday, leave Auckland later today to travel north to Whangārei for tomorrow's game at Okara Park.

The Barbarians are comprised of players from New Zealand's semi-professional provincial competition and considered the easiest opposition the Lions will face on their gruelling tour.

The Lions will also play all five Super Rugby teams, the Māori All Blacks and three tests against the All Blacks.

New Zealand born centre Ben Te'o is in the starting fifteen while another New Zealand born player Mako Vunipola is in the reserves.

Revised Lions squad: 15-Stuart Hogg, 14-Anthony Watson, 13-Jonathan Joseph, 12-Ben Te'o, 11-Tommy Seymour, 10-Johnny Sexton, 9-Greig Laidlaw; 8-Taulupe Faletau, 7-Sam Warburton (captain), 6-Ross Moriarty, 5-Iain Henderson, 4-Alun Wyn Jones, 3-Kyle Sinckler, 2-Rory Best, 1-Joe Marler

Replacements: 16-Jamie George, 17-Mako Vunipola, 18-Tadhg Furlong, 19-George Kruis, 20-Justin Tipuric, 21-Rhys Webb, 22-Owen Farrell, 23-Elliot Daly
